Job Description

AECOM’s Water Business Line is seeking a highly motivated and experienced Principal Water/Wastewater Engineer with a passion for water and wastewater conveyance, treatment plant design, and infrastructure resiliency. This position offers an exceptional opportunity to contribute immediately to an established and successful Southern California water practice, delivering technically challenging and high-profile projects for regional and municipal clients.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ide technical leadership on complex civil and water infrastructure projects from planning through permitting and construction.
  • Offer technical guidance and mentorship to junior engineers and design staff.
  • Lead and coordinate multi-disciplinary design teams, both locally and virtually.
  • Manage civil, stormwater, and resiliency design projects.
  • Oversee hydraulic modeling and design of water and wastewater conveyance systems.
  • Review and prepare engineering reports, design drawings, technical specifications, and cost estimates.
  • Lead the preparation of engineering proposals, fee estimates, and project schedules.
  • Stay current with industry trends, design technologies, and regulatory developments.

Qualifications

Minimum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Civil, Mechanical, or Environmental Engineering.
  • 10+ years of relevant experience, or an equivalent combination of education and experience, with emphasis in water/wastewater or related fields.
  • Registered Professional Engineer (PE) in California, or ability to obtain within 6 months of hire.
  • Valid U.S. driver’s license and ability to pass AECOM’s Motor Vehicle Record (MVR) review.

Preferred Qualifications

  • 18+ years of experience in the design, analysis, and management of municipal water, wastewater, and/or stormwater infrastructure projects, particularly within dense urban environments.
  • In-depth knowledge of design codes, standards, and regulatory requirements for water/wastewater/stormwater projects.
  • Proven leadership and communication skills for client, subconsultant, and agency coordination.
  • Strong organizational and team collaboration skills.
  • Demonstrated ability to independently solve engineering problems and make technical decisions.
  • Excellent technical writing and report preparation skills.
  • Experience preparing engineering deliverables including reports, drawings, specifications, and estimates.
  • Track record of delivering resiliency, stormwater, and flood protection projects.

Additional Information

  • Relocation assistance is not available for this position.
  • Sponsorship for U.S. employment authorization is not available, now or in the future.
  • Compensation will be determined based on the candidate’s location, experience, and qualifications.
